Envalior GmbH, a leading name in the polymer and advanced materials industry, is headquartered in Germany and operates across key regions in Europe and beyond. Founded in 2021, the company has quickly established itself as a pioneer in sustainable solutions, focusing on high-performance materials that cater to diverse applications, including automotive, electronics, and consumer goods. Envalior's core offerings include innovative thermoplastics and composites, distinguished by their exceptional durability and eco-friendly properties. The company’s commitment to sustainability and cutting-edge technology has positioned it as a market leader, earning recognition for its contributions to reducing environmental impact. With a strong emphasis on research and development, Envalior continues to push the boundaries of material science, setting new standards in the industry.

Envalior GmbH, headquartered in Germany, currently does not have publicly available carbon emissions data for recent years. As such, specific figures regarding their carbon footprint, including Scope 1, 2, or 3 emissions, are not disclosed.
